Ski Jumping
Ski jumping is up and running on the "D" hill, behind the lodge
at the Leavenworth Ski Hill this winter. Kjell Bakke and his volunteers
are out every Wednesday and Friday night from 6-8:30pm and every Saturday
and Sunday from 10:00am to 2:00pm. Skiers of all ages are encouraged to
come out and give jumping a try. You need not have special gear, just your
alpine or telemark skis and boots, plus a helmet. Coaches are on hand to
instruct.
Downhill
Skiing & Snowboarding at Ski Hill
Just north of town on Wenatchee National Forest property, the Leavenworth
Ski Hill offers downhill skiing on two groomed hills serviced by rope
tows. It is open four days a week (three of which include night skiing)
and all school holidays. Food, beverages and warmth are available at the
historic Ski Hill Lodge. Alpine daily passes cost $8.00 for skiers age 6
to 64; seniors ski for free and children age five and under ski free on
the Bunny Hill. Alpine memberships includes a season pass at the Ski Hill,
Skier News and voting rights. Combined memberships include season passes
for both Nordic and alpine skiing. All members are encouraged to attend
meetings and volunteer at the Ski Hill.
